Description

Built in 1998 and designed by Ian Anderson, CANTARA OF RHU is a rare Seastream 465 and one of only a limited number produced. This hand-built, bluewater cruising yacht features a sea-kindly hull, secure cockpit, and raised deck saloon, offering comfort and visibility below. The cutter rig is easily managed, and the interior includes two double cabins, one twin, and quality joinery throughout. Based on Scotland’s west coast since 2004, she’s been well maintained and wintered ashore annually at Silvers Marine. A standout 15m deck saloon yacht with pedigree, ideal for serious cruising.

Overwintering & Routine Maintenance

Annually since 2004 she has been slipped around mid-September and laid up in a purpose boat hanger along with other yachts at Silvers Marine Rosneath. The mast is racked in a mast shed. She has been launched around late-April. For the past 20 years she has then been laid up indoors for over 7 months each year. In 2020 she was not launched. The annual programme of routine preventative and corrective maintenance includes the following:

 

  • In colder months, a dehumidifier and 1/4kw heater are set up internally.
  • Antifouling is pressure washed and Scotbright pad manually scrubbed.
  • Two coats of Micron Extra antifouling biennially.
  • Topside Starbright hull cleaner wash.
  • Topside manual G4 cut followed by resin/wax polish.
  • Chains and anchors are lowered to ground to dry out and repaint depth markings as indicated.
  • Fresh water tank drained.
  • Grey tank and drains – Biological/enzyme drain cleaner added.
  • Both boat and generator engines are winterised by circulating fresh water antifreeze in the raw water systems.
  • Engine oil change.
  • Gearbox oil change.
  • Racor and Perkins diesel filters changed.
  • Engine Perkins oil filter change.
  • Engine raw water impellor changed biennially.
  • Coolant checked and topped up.
  • Coolant has been fully drained and changed 3 times.
  • Generator oil changed biennially.
  • Generator fuel and oil filters changed biennially.
  • Generator impellor changed occasionally.
  • Generator coolant checked and topped up.
  • Bilges cleaned and bilge pumps and float switches checked and cleared.
  • Diesel fuel tank has been opened, checked, and cleaned out on one occasion. Minimal sediment and no evidence of diesel bug.
  • Grey tank has been opened and cleaned out twice.
  • Galley stove removed and thoroughly cleaned.
  • Varnish work and paint work as indicated.
  • Windlass oil change occasionally.
  • Carpets removed and washed.
  • Carpets replaced 4 or 5 yearly.
  • Mast and spars cleaned and polished.
  • Sails to sailmaker to be checked, laundered. repaired and stored.
  • Zinc anodes checked and replaced as necessary.
  • Upholstery. Alcantara panels replaced when worn.
  • Teak decks -   Boracol 5Rh biocide treatment – 2 to 3 yearly.
  • New gas regulator occasionally.
  • Locker catches frequently replaced.
  • Electrical and electronic attention as necessary.
  • Numerous other small jobs as indicated.
